A new strain sensor based on depth-modulated long-period fiber grating

2020 
Abstract In this paper, a novel strain sensor based on Depth-Modulated Long Period Fiber Grating (DM-LPFG) is presented and demonstrated. One side polished deformations with different milling depth are fabricated by a high frequency CO2 laser, so the DM-LPFG possesses a staircase-shaped structure. This kind of structure provides the high strain sensitivity of DM-LPFG. Experimental results clearly demonstrate that the structure has excellent mechanical capacity and repeatability. The sensor has a considerable strain sensitivity, which can reach up to 27.4 pm/μe with the range of 0-450 μe, it is an order of magnitude higher than conventional CO2 laser induced LPFG. The temperature characteristic is 49 pm/℃ with the range of 30-170 ℃. Furthermore, the strain sensor possesses a compact structure, with a total length of 9 mm.
